About This Book
A systematic Reformed treatment of humanity's fallen condition and God's providence, tracing creation's transition to preservation and the sovereign governance that orders all events. It analyzes the possibility, origin, essence, spread, and punishment of sin while balancing human responsibility with divine sovereignty. The person and work of the Mediator are presented within the covenant of grace, and the redemptive office of Christ is carefully examined. The volume concludes with the benefits of the covenant and a concise ordo salutis, addressing calling and regeneration, faith and justification, and sanctification and perseverance through sustained biblical exegesis and doctrinal reflection.
